Right-click a blank space on the toolbar area and check Formatting. Of
course, that presumes you're composing in a message format that allows
formatting (ie., HTML or Rich Text).

That means you're using the built-in Outlook editor, so on a new message
window, you should be able to right-click an empty area near the Standard
toolbar and see "Formatting" (or by clicking Toolbars under View, as you
describe), unless you;re using an Outlook version with which I'm unfamiliar.
